If you’re looking to buy a home in the Albuquerque area and are looking for a community that’s both far from everything and close to everything, then Placitas is the place! People are drawn to Placitas for many reasons. The weather, the tranquility, the hiking – there’s something here for everyone.
Buying a home in Placitas means you’ll be close to both Albuquerque and Rio Rancho, as well as only 50 miles from Santa Fe. That’s what makes this such a great bedroom community. You can have the best of both worlds here.
Living in Placitas put’s you within arm’s reach of great food and shopping. There are a number of great restaurants locally, as well as a much larger selection of places to dine and shop in Albuquerque.
What really draws people to live in Placitas is the stunning landscape and outdoor activities due to being located at the foothills of the Sandia Mountains, along with biking trails closer to town.
